The Anatomy of a Data Breach

A data breach, like the one involving Isla Moon, typically involves unauthorized access to sensitive, protected, or confidential data. While the specifics of the "Isla Moon corporation's headquarters" and the exact method of the breach are not publicly detailed in the provided information, such incidents often stem from:

  • Weak Security Measures: Insufficient encryption, outdated software, or poorly configured servers can create entry points for malicious actors.
  • Phishing Attacks: Social engineering tactics used to trick individuals into revealing login credentials or other sensitive information.
  • Insider Threats: Disgruntled employees or individuals with authorized access misusing their privileges.
  • Malware or Ransomware: Malicious software designed to infiltrate systems and extract or encrypt data.
  • Third-Party Vulnerabilities: If Isla Moon or her platform relied on third-party services (e.g., payment processors, content delivery networks), a vulnerability in one of those services could lead to a leak.

Regardless of the specific vector, the outcome is the same: sensitive data, which in this case included exclusive content and potentially personal user information, becomes accessible to unauthorized individuals. Proactive Measures for Online Safety

To mitigate the risks of data breaches and enhance online safety, creators and users alike should consider implementing the following measures:

  • Strong, Unique Passwords: Use complex passwords for every online account and avoid reusing them.
  • Two-Factor Authentication (2FA): Enable 2FA wherever possible, adding an extra layer of security to accounts.
  • Regular Software Updates: Keep operating systems, applications, and security software updated to patch vulnerabilities.
  • Secure Network Practices: Avoid public Wi-Fi for sensitive activities and use a Virtual Private Network (VPN) when necessary.
  • Phishing Awareness: Be skeptical of suspicious emails, messages, or links that ask for personal information.
  • Data Minimization: Only share essential personal data when absolutely necessary.
  • Regular Data Backups: Back up important data to secure, offline locations.
  • Platform Due Diligence: Creators should thoroughly vet any third-party services or tools they integrate with their platforms.
  • Privacy Settings Review: Regularly review and adjust privacy settings on all social media and content platforms.

The Unyielding Nature of Online Information

One of the most sobering lessons from the **Isla Moon leak** is the enduring and often unyielding nature of online information. Once data, especially sensitive content, is leaked onto the internet, it becomes incredibly difficult, if not impossible, to fully erase. This is due to several factors:

  • Rapid Dissemination: Leaked content spreads like wildfire across various platforms, forums, and peer-to-peer networks.
  • Mirror Sites and Archives: Even if original sources are taken down, mirror sites and archival services often preserve the content.
  • Decentralized Networks: The internet's decentralized nature makes it challenging to pinpoint and remove every copy of leaked data.
  • Human Curiosity: The very human tendency to seek out controversial or forbidden content fuels the continued sharing and re-uploading of leaked material.
